Transaction 98520d3e0d18b5bb0c49ffdb7c40f7436c25c0971ac1590a41de26b9eee28138

2 Input
2 Outputs
  • 98520d3e0d18b5bb0c49ffdb7c40f7436c25c0971ac1590a41de26b9eee28138:0
  • value  11505335
    address  146yhTcpzwopfUPNawDNZRtf9sZzyxdce2
  • 98520d3e0d18b5bb0c49ffdb7c40f7436c25c0971ac1590a41de26b9eee28138:1
  • value  28763
    address  3D15BZMLNtWGkoJnjPxxWWiitgT2xnCCAJ